🔍 What Makes a Laptop Charger “Universal”?
A universal laptop charger works across multiple brands and models instead of being designed for one device.
Most modern universal chargers rely on USB-C Power Delivery, which automatically negotiates voltage and power levels between the charger and the laptop.

🔍 Choosing the Right Wattage for a Universal Charger
Laptop chargers vary widely in power output depending on device type.
Thin ultrabooks often charge using 45W–65W adapters, while larger performance laptops may require 90W or more. Chargers with higher wattage can safely power smaller laptops because USB-C Power Delivery adjusts the output automatically.
Understanding power requirements helps ensure your charger can deliver enough power for stable charging.

🟢 FAQs
Q: Can a universal laptop charger work with any laptop?
Most modern laptops that support USB-C Power Delivery can use universal chargers, though older devices with proprietary connectors may require brand-specific adapters.
Q: Is a higher-wattage charger safe for a smaller laptop?
Yes. USB-C Power Delivery automatically adjusts power output based on the laptop’s requirements.
Q: Do universal chargers charge multiple devices at the same speed?
Charging speed may vary when multiple devices are connected because the charger distributes power between ports.
